    Background

    IL15 antibody detects interleukin 15, a pleiotropic cytokine encoded by the IL15 gene. IL15 belongs to the four alpha helix bundle cytokine family and shares functional similarities with interleukin 2. It plays a crucial role in the activation and survival of natural killer cells and memory CD8 T cells. IL15 signals through a receptor complex composed of IL15R alpha, IL2R beta, and the common gamma chain. Through these interactions, IL15 contributes to immune homeostasis, antiviral defense, and antitumor activity.

    IL15 plays roles in autoimmune disease, chronic inflammation, and transplant rejection. Elevated levels contribute to pathological immune activation in conditions such as rheumatoid arthritis, psoriasis, and celiac disease. Conversely, inadequate IL15 signaling impairs immune defense against viral infections. By applying IL15 antibody, researchers can investigate both protective and pathogenic functions of this cytokine.

    In addition to its role in adaptive immunity, IL15 regulates innate lymphoid cell function and promotes tissue specific immune surveillance. It is particularly important in mucosal immunity, where it supports barrier protection against pathogens. IL15 antibody therefore provides a versatile tool for basic and translational immunology.
